Discounts are available to cut your rates

Auto insurance companies don’t always advertise every discount in an easy-to-find place, so we break down some of the more common as well as the least known discounts you could be receiving.

  • Defensive Driver – Successfully completing a course in driver safety could possibly earn you a 5% discount if your company offers it.
  • College Student – Children who are attending college and don’t have a car may be able to be covered for less.
  • Discount for New Cars – Insuring a new car can save up to 30% because new vehicles have to meet stringent safety requirements.
  • Anti-theft Discount – Cars that have factory anti-theft systems prevent vehicle theft and therefore earn up to a 10% discount.
  • Fewer Miles Equal More Savings – Keeping the miles down on your Cadillac can qualify you for lower rates on the low mileage vehicles.

Drivers should understand that most discount credits are not given to your bottom line cost. Most only cut the cost of specific coverages such as comprehensive or collision. So when it seems like you could get a free insurance policy, insurance companies aren’t that generous.

Lesser-known factors impacting Cadillac Seville insurance rates

It’s important that you understand the rating factors that play a part in calculating your insurance coverage rates. Having a good understanding of what controls the rates you pay enables informed choices that may reward you with much lower annual insurance costs.

Shown below are some of the factors insurance coverage companies consider when setting rates.

  • Don’t skimp on liability – Your policy’s liability coverage provides coverage in the event that you are found to be at fault for damages from an accident. Liability provides legal defense coverage which can be incredibly expensive. Liability is cheap as compared to coverage for physical damage, so do not skimp.
  • Increase deductibles and save – Insurance for physical damage to your car, commonly called comprehensive (or other-than-collision) and collision coverage, protects your Cadillac from damage. A few examples of covered claims are a windshield shattered by a rock, damage caused by hail, or theft. Your deductibles are the amount of money you are willing to pay before your insurance coverage pays a claim. The more you have to pay, the bigger discount you will receive for Seville coverage.
  • Where do you drive? – Driving more miles in a year’s time the more you’ll pay to insure your vehicle. Almost all companies charge to insure your cars based on their usage. Cars that are left in the garage can get a lower rate than those used for commuting. Verify your insurance coverage coverage properly reflects the proper vehicle usage, because it can save money. Incorrect usage on your Seville can cost quite a bit.
  • Policy add-ons can waste money – There are quite a few extra bells and whistles that you can get tricked into buying on your Seville policy. Things like rental car reimbursement, accidental death and additional equipment coverage may be wasting your money. They may seem good initially, but now you might not need them so remove them from your policy.
  • Your occupation can affect rates – Occupations like doctors, architects and dentists are shown to have the highest average rates due to high stress and long work hours. Other occupations like scientists, historians and the unemployed pay the least for Seville coverage.
  • Where you live – Residing in a rural area is a positive aspect when insuring your vehicles. Less people living in that area translates into fewer accidents as well as less vandalism and auto theft. City drivers regularly have more traffic problems and longer commutes to work. Higher commute times can result in more accidents.

Can switching companies really save?

Companies like State Farm, Allstate and Geico constantly bombard you with television and radio advertisements. All the ads say the same thing about savings if you switch your coverage to them. How do they all claim to save you money? This is how they do it.

Different companies have a certain “appetite” for the type of driver that makes them money. A good example of a preferred risk could be over the age of 50, has no prior claims, and has excellent credit. A customer who fits that profile gets the lowest rates and therefore will pay quite a bit less when switching companies.

Potential insureds who fall outside the requirements will have to pay higher prices which leads to business going elsewhere. The ads state “customers who switch” not “everybody who quotes” save that much. That’s why companies can state the savings. Because of the profiling, it’s extremely important to get quotes from several different companies. It’s impossible to know which insurance companies will have the lowest Cadillac Seville insurance rates.

Learn about insurance coverages for a Cadillac Seville

Having a good grasp of a insurance policy aids in choosing the right coverages at the best deductibles and correct limits. The terms used in a policy can be confusing and even agents have difficulty translating policy wording. Listed below are typical coverage types available from insurance companies.

Uninsured/Underinsured Motorist (UM/UIM)

Uninsured or Underinsured Motorist coverage protects you and your vehicle from other motorists when they either are underinsured or have no liability coverage at all. Covered claims include injuries sustained by your vehicle’s occupants as well as your vehicle’s damage.

Due to the fact that many drivers have only the minimum liability required by law, it only takes a small accident to exceed their coverage. For this reason, having high UM/UIM coverages is very important.

Collision insurance

This coverage will pay to fix damage to your Seville resulting from a collision with another vehicle or an object, but not an animal. You have to pay a deductible then your collision coverage will kick in.

Collision coverage protects against claims such as crashing into a ditch, scraping a guard rail, rolling your car, backing into a parked car and driving through your garage door. Collision coverage makes up a good portion of your premium, so consider dropping it from vehicles that are 8 years or older. Drivers also have the option to raise the deductible to bring the cost down.

Med pay and Personal Injury Protection (PIP)

Coverage for medical payments and/or PIP provide coverage for bills like pain medications, surgery, doctor visits and chiropractic care. The coverages can be used to cover expenses not covered by your health insurance policy or if you do not have health coverage. They cover both the driver and occupants and will also cover getting struck while a pedestrian. PIP is only offered in select states but can be used in place of medical payments coverage

Liability car insurance

Liability coverage provides protection from damage or injury you incur to people or other property that is your fault. It protects YOU from claims by other people, and does not provide coverage for your injuries or vehicle damage.

Coverage consists of three different limits, bodily injury for each person, bodily injury for the entire accident, and a limit for property damage. As an example, you may have policy limits of 50/100/50 which means a $50,000 limit per person for injuries, a limit of $100,000 in injury protection per accident, and a limit of $50,000 paid for damaged property.

Liability can pay for claims like attorney fees, bail bonds, funeral expenses and structural damage. How much liability coverage do you need? That is your choice, but it’s cheap coverage so purchase higher limits if possible.

Comprehensive insurance

Comprehensive insurance pays to fix your vehicle from damage caused by mother nature, theft, vandalism and other events. You need to pay your deductible first and the remainder of the damage will be paid by comprehensive coverage.

Comprehensive coverage pays for claims like damage from a tornado or hurricane, hitting a bird and hitting a deer. The maximum payout your insurance company will pay is the actual cash value, so if the vehicle’s value is low it’s not worth carrying full coverage.
